About Us

MADISONVILLE HOPKINS COUNTY BOARD

OF REALTORS® HISTORY

 

On May 10, 1966 the Madisonville-Hopkins County Board of REALTORS® was chartered through the NATIONAL ASSOCIATION OF REALTORS®. In February, 1975 the Madisonville-Hopkins County Board of REALTORS® was incorporated and Bill Rudd, Sr. served as President. When the Board was first started, the MLS book was a loose leaf notebook with a   part-time MLS person. 1976 brought the change of a bound MLS book and a part-time secretary for both the Board and the MLS. Many changes have taken place throughout the years – such as the MLS being incorporated and then being dissolved and formed as a committee of the Board, members going from picking up keys of listed properties from the listing offices to operating an electronic lockbox and key system, from having as many as three employees to having one and from doing things by hand to becoming fully computerized. They now own their own building at 275 South Main Street, Madisonville, KY 42431, occupying suite A while renting out suite B.
